1996-99 ELANTRA DRIP RAIL WEATHERSTRIP
DESCRIPTION:
This bulletin describes the prncedure for replacement of a damaged drip rail weatherstrip.
PROCEDURE:
1. Remove the old Drip Rail Weatherstripping from the affected door. Clean the metal flange and facing which runs along the door with "Prepsol" or equivalent cleaner. On Sedans, note the two roof rack mounting screws over each door.
2. Run a small bead of silicon adhessive "Permatex / Loctite Black Silicone Adhesive (# 81158) or equivalent" inside the groove on the backside of the drip rail weatherstrip.
NOTE:
On sedans, leave gaps in the adhesive next to the roof rack mounting screws.
3. Starting from the rear door, hook the end of the drip rail weatherstrip over the end of the metal flange. Work towards the front, pushing the weatherstrip onto the flange. Be careful not to stretch the weatherstrip. Make sure it is fully seated on the flange and that the front of the weatherstrip aligns with the body fastener holes. If not slide the weatherstrip until the holes align and screw in the two body fasteners to hold the front end of the drip rail weatherstrip in place.
